1. Understanding Audi A5 B9 VCDS Coding
VCDS (Vag-Com Diagnostic System) coding is the process of using specialized software and hardware to modify the factory settings of your Audi A5 B9’s electronic control units (ECUs). These ECUs govern various aspects of the vehicle’s operation, from engine performance to comfort features. VCDS coding allows you to tap into these settings and personalize your driving experience.
1.1. What is VCDS?
VCDS is a comprehensive diagnostic tool developed by Ross-Tech. It allows you to communicate with your Audi A5 B9’s ECUs, read di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s), perform advanced diagnostics, and, most importantly, perform coding changes. VCDS consists of a software application that runs on a Windows-based computer and a diagnostic interface that connects your computer to the vehicle’s OBD-II port.
1.2. Key Components of a VCDS System
A complete VCDS system comprises two essential components:
- VCDS Software: This is the core application that allows you to interact with your vehicle’s ECUs. It provides a user-friendly interface for accessing diagnostic information, performing coding changes, and logging data. The latest version is always recommended for optimal compatibility and functionality.
- Diagnostic Interface: This is the hardware interface that connects your computer to your Audi A5 B9’s OBD-II port. It acts as a translator between your computer and the vehicle’s electronic systems. Ross-Tech offers various interfaces, each with different features and capabilities.

1.4. Safety Precautions for VCDS Coding
While VCDS coding offers many benefits, it’s crucial to approach it with caution and awareness. Incorrect coding can lead to malfunctions or even damage to your vehicle’s electronic systems. Adhere to these safety precautions:
- Backup Original Coding: Always create a backup of your vehicle’s original coding before making any changes. This allows you to revert to the original settings if something goes wrong.
- Use Reliable Information: Only use coding guides and instructions from reputable sources. Avoid experimenting with unknown coding parameters.
- Understand the Changes: Make sure you fully understand the function of any coding change you’re making. If you’re unsure, seek advice from experienced VCDS users or professionals.
- Battery Voltage: Ensure your vehicle’s battery is fully charged before starting any coding session. Low voltage can cause errors during the coding process.
- Stable Connection: Maintain a stable connection between your computer and the vehicle’s OBD-II port throughout the coding process.

2.1.1. Window Auto Drop/Raise with Remote Key
This modification enables you to fully open or close all windows by holding the unlock or lock button on your remote key.
- Function: Provides convenient control of windows from a distance.
- Coding Steps:
- Select module
09 - Central Electrics
. - Select
Security Access - 16
and enter the security code (usually31347
). - Select
Adaptation - 10
. - Search for
(14)-Comfort operation remote control-active
. - Change the value to
active
. - Search for
(13)-Comfort operation remote control- open
. - Change the value to
active
. - Search for
(15)-Comfort operation remote control-close
. - Change the value to
active
.
- Select module
- Benefits: Convenient for ventilation in hot weather or quickly closing windows in case of rain.
2.1.2. HVAC Recirculation Memory
This modification allows the HVAC system to remember your last recirculation setting when you restart the vehicle.
- Function: Remembers the recirculation setting.
- Coding Steps:
- Select module
08 - Auto HVAC
. - Select
Adaptation - 10
. - Search for
"(ENG116829)-IDE02518-Reset of recirculation air flap position after terminal 15 OFF"
. - Change the value to
Last Setting
.
- Select module
- Benefits: Prevents unwanted outside air from entering the cabin when you prefer recirculation mode.

2.2.1. Display Gear Number in Virtual Cockpit
This modification displays the current gear number in the virtual cockpit, providing additional information to the driver.
- Function: Shows gear number in the virtual cockpit.
- Coding Steps:
- Select module
17 - Instruments
. - Select
Adaptation - 10
. - Search for
Display gear
. - Change the value to
D on/S on
.
- Select module
- Benefits: Provides a clear indication of the selected gear.
2.2.2. Enable Laptimer
This modification enables the laptimer function in the driver information system, allowing you to record lap times on the track.
- Function: Activates laptimer feature.
- Coding Steps:
- Select module
17 - Instruments
. - Select
Coding - 07
. - Long Coding Helper will open.
- Enable the
Laptimer
option.
- Select module
- Benefits: Useful for track days and performance enthusiasts.
2.2.3. Enable Sports Computer
Enables additional performance data display in the MMI, such as oil temperature and boost pressure.
- Function: Activates sports computer display.
- Coding Steps:
- Select module
5F - Information Electr.
. - Select
Adaptation - 10
. - Search for
Car_Function_Adaptations_Gen2-menu_display_sports_computer
. - Change the value to
activated
. - Search for
Car_Function_Adaptations_Gen2-menu_display_sports_computer_over_threshold_high
. - Change the value to
activated
.
- Select module
- Benefits: Provides real-time performance data for enthusiasts.

2.5.1. Rear Brake Pad Change
This modification puts the electronic parking brake into service mode, allowing you to change the rear brake pads.
- Function: Enables rear brake pad replacement.
- Coding Steps:
- Select module
53 - Parking Brake
. - Select
Basic Settings - 04
. - Select
Start Brake Pad Change
. - Follow the on-screen instructions.
- Select module
- Benefits: Allows for DIY brake pad replacement, saving on labor costs.

3. VCDS Coding: Step-by-Step Guide
Here’s a general step-by-step guide to performing VCDS coding on your Audi A5 B9:
-
Connect VCDS Interface: Plug the VCDS diagnostic interface into your vehicle’s OBD-II port.
-
Turn on Ignition: Turn on the vehicle’s ignition but do not start the engine.
-
Launch VCDS Software: Open the VCDS software on your Windows-based computer.
-
Select Control Module: Choose the appropriate control module that you want to modify (e.g.,
09 - Central Electrics
,17 - Instruments
). -
Access Coding/Adaptation: Depending on the modification you want to perform, select either
Coding - 07
orAdaptation - 10
. -
Backup Original Coding: Before making any changes, always backup the original coding by saving the current settings to a file.
-
Make Changes: Follow the specific coding steps for the modification you want to perform. This may involve using the Long Coding Helper, entering specific values, or selecting options from a dropdown menu.
-
Save Changes: Once you’ve made the desired changes, save the new coding or adaptation settings.
-
Test the Modification: After saving the changes, test the modification to ensure it’s working as expected.
-
Troubleshooting: If you encounter any issues, revert to the original coding and seek assistance from experienced VCDS users or professionals.
